Transaction 757078842161ade5132aad6cbb0363e646950da497f571b0c44e0e5b79384b66
1 Input
1 Output
-
757078842161ade5132aad6cbb0363e646950da497f571b0c44e0e5b79384b66:0
- value
- 1161017
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1348c0bb7c31894596500344335fbe136b8dda2e OP_EQUAL
- address
- 33Syv9R8Fh1EZSXEhhywr381Gcg4Ka2KTR